No duct required

Unlike window units, ductless heating and cooling systems require only a very small hole to be drilled into the wall, which allows them to be less vulnerable to air leakage and security problems. Even better, they are energy-efficient, make way less noise, blend in better with your home. Ductless systems offer highly flexible solutions.

Traditional heating and cooling systems force cooled and heated air through ducts, whereas ductless heating and cooling systems deliver air directly into different zones. Typically, they consist of a small outdoor unit and one or more indoor units that simply need mounting capabilities and access to electricity.
